Components of the Omega Masticating Juicer

The Omega masticating juicer is not just a simple kitchen gadget. Its design comprises several pivotal components, all tailored to optimize juice extraction. Here, we’ll break down these parts:

1. Juicing Auger

It's the heart of the juicing mechanism. The auger crushes the fruits and vegetables slowly, extracting juice while preserving nutrients. Unlike centrifugal juicers, the slow extraction minimizes oxidation and preserves the flavor.

2. Juicing Screen

Often made from sturdy material, the juicing screen separates juice from pulp. Depending on the juicer model, the size of the holes can vary, impacting the clarity and texture of your juice.

3. Pulp Ejection Spout

An essential component for continuous juicing. It allows for efficient pulp removal, preventing clogging and ensuring that each batch of juice is produced without interruption.

4. Juice Container

Usually made from BPA-free plastic, where the juice collects. Some models even come with a measuring scale marked on the side, making it easier to portion out your drinks.

5. Power Base

The base is where the motor resides, providing the necessary power for the overall operation. A robust and quiet motor ensures that the juicer can handle tough ingredients like ginger or leafy greens without breaking a sweat.

6. Locking Mechanism

This ensures that all parts are securely attached during operation. A well-designed locking mechanism enhances safety while juicing, reducing the risk of accidents in the kitchen.

How the Auger Works

Delving into the mechanics, the auger utilizes a gentle yet effective action to extract juice. As ingredients are fed into the juicer, the auger rotates slowly, piercing and compressing the fruits or vegetables against the juicing screen. This compression generates pressure, squeezing out the juice while leaving behind the pulp. Unlike centrifugal juicers that spin rapidly and create heat, the auger's slow speed minimizes oxidation, maintaining the juice's freshness.

Follow along with how the process unfolds:

  • Feeding: Ingredients are fed through the chute, where the auger begins its work.
  • Crushing: As the auger rotates, it crushes the material, breaking down cell walls and releasing natural juices.
  • Pressing: The juice is pressed through the juicing screen, while the dry pulp is pushed out into the separate container.

This methodical approach means the juice not only tastes better but lasts longer in terms of storage life.

Cleaning Procedures

Cleaning your juicer might seem like a chore, but it's essential to prevent buildup of any residue that could affect the flavor and quality of your juice. Here’s how to effectively clean your Omega masticating juicer:

  1. Disassemble the Juicer: Start by carefully taking apart the juicer, separating the auger, juicing screen, and any other removable parts.
  2. Rinse with Water: Quickly rinse the components under warm running water. This will help to loosen any pulp or residue stuck to the surfaces.
  3. Use a Brush: Utilizing a specialized cleaning brush can reach those tricky spots on the juicing screen and auger where grime can hide. It’s often recommended to use a soft-bristle brush to avoid scratching the surfaces.
  4. Mild Soap Solution: If there’s stubborn residue, you can soak the parts in a warm solution of mild soap and warm water for a few minutes. Avoid using harsh chemicals as these can wear down the material over time.
  5. Dry Completely: Always dry each part thoroughly before reassembling. Moisture can lead to mold growth, which isn't something you want in your kitchen appliance.

Cleaning your juicer right after use can take just a few minutes and will save you hours of struggle later.

When the Juicer Stops Working

If your Omega masticating juicer suddenly comes to a halt, it can be frustrating, especially if you're in the midst of preparing delicious juice. First things first, check if the juicer is plugged into a working outlet. Sometimes, it’s as simple as needing to switch the plug or trying another socket.

If power isn’t the issue, the next step is to consider the overload protection feature. Masticating juicers are designed with safety in mind; if something is amiss, such as excessive pressure from overloading it with produce, the machine will automatically shut down. Wait a few moments, then reset the unit by turning it off, letting it cool, and turning it back on. This reset often resolves the issue.

If it still doesn’t operate, disassemble the juicer to check for any blockages. Food remnants may get lodged in the auger or juicing screen, preventing movement. Clear out any obstructive pieces and give everything a good cleaning. You might find that a simple blockage is at fault. Finally, consult the manual for any specific troubleshooting advice tailored to your model.

Slow Juice Extraction

Slow juice extraction can be another common hiccup during juicing. When your juicer takes an eternity to produce juice, it can leave you second-guessing its efficiency.

First, consider the types of fruits and vegetables you are using. Harder produce, like carrots and beets, typically requires more time. If your juicer is having difficulty, try cutting these items into smaller chunks before juicing.

Ensure that the juicing screen is not clogged. A buildup can impede the flow of juice, slowing extraction significantly. Regular maintenance, including cleaning the screen after every use, keeps things moving swiftly. You might also want to check the auger—if it’s not rotating freely, it could indicate a more serious issue like wear or damage.

Here are some quick checks:

  • Inspect the juicing screen: Clean it thoroughly to prevent slow flow.
  • Cut the produce smaller: Makes it easier for the auger to process.
  • Monitor the auger: Ensure it’s turning properly and there’s no obstruction.

Comparing Masticating and Centrifugal Juicers

When diving into the world of juicing, one might stumble upon two primary types of juicers: masticating and centrifugal. Understanding the differences between these two machines is crucial for anyone looking to maximize their juicing experience. Each technology has its strengths and weaknesses, and knowing what suits your needs best can lead to a more flavorful and nutritious output.

Juicing Efficiency

Juicing efficiency refers to the ability of a juicer to extract juice from fruits and vegetables with minimal waste. In this aspect, masticating juicers, like those from Omega, tend to shine. They operate at a slower speed, which allows the auger to thoroughly crush and squeeze the produce, ensuring nearly every drop of juice is extracted. This slow extraction process results in a higher yield compared to centrifugal juicers, which utilize rapid spinning to separate juice from pulp.

Here are some key points regarding juicing efficiency:

  • Yield: Masticating juicers generally produce more juice from the same amount of produce due to their thorough mechanisms.
  • Nutrient Preservation: The gentle extraction process minimizes heat and oxidation, preserving nutrients and enzymes better than centrifugal counterparts.
  • Versatility: Masticating juicers can typically handle a wider variety of ingredients, including leafy greens and nuts, providing options for smoothies and nut milks.

In contrast, centrifugal juicers, while quicker and often cheaper, can leave more pulp behind and might need more frequent cleaning due to their fast-spinning blades. This can lead to more effort, for less efficiency.

Taste and Texture of Juice

Taste and texture are often subjective, yet they play a huge role in choosing a juicer. Masticating juicers usually produce juice that is richer and thicker in texture. This is largely due to their method of extraction, which maintains the cell structure of fruits and vegetables.

Here's how taste and texture fare between the two:

  • Flavor Profile: Masticating juices often boast bolder and fresher flavors since the juice is less exposed to heat and oxidation during extraction. This preserves the original taste of the ingredients.
  • Mouthfeel: The thicker consistency of juice from masticating juicers can provide a more satisfying drinking experience, particularly in smoothies and health drinks.
  • Freshness Duration: Juices from masticating machines can typically last longer in the fridge without degrading quickly, maintaining their taste and nutritional integrity.

On the flip side, centrifugal juicers tend to produce a thinner juice, which some may find less appealing. The rapid oxidation can lead to diminished taste and quicker spoilage, often resulting in a compromise on quality for the sake of speed.
